Should I be Concerned
Looking back through my Sleepyhead data, I find several days where I've experience periodic breathing.  Should this be a concern for Cheyne Stokes?

RE: Should I be Concerned
That is absolutely NOT CSR.  It is entirely obstructive in nature and it is clustered Obstructive events which means it is likely your chin tucking.  If this is a one off forget about it but if it occurs frequently get a loose fitting soft cervical collar or an anti-snoring collar such as the Dr Dakotka (there are others).  These devices have had very good success at stopping these clustered obstructive events.
